Summary

Morgan & Morgan is looking for an experienced Personal Injury Litigation Attorney to join its growing practice of plaintiff's lawyers and supporting case staff in our office in Richmond, Virginia. The Litigation Attorney will handle motor vehicle liability / automobile accident cases in litigation representing plaintiffs in Virginia. The lawyer's responsibilities will be focused on litigating cases, including trial prep and trial, but will not have to generally handle pre-suit matters. Our law firm's generous and competitive compensation includes a base salary, non-recoverable draw, and standard commission fees / bonuses, as well as a full benefits package.

Responsibilities
  • Day-to-day handling of litigation cases
  • Drafting and filing of litigation documents to include pleadings, discovery requests, discovery responses, demands, motions and memoranda
  • Guide plaintiff clients through the case process
  • Interaction with expert witnesses to include conferences, drafting of expert reports and affidavits
  • Attendance and preparation for depositions, mediations, hearings, and court appearances

Qualifications
  • Law degree (J.D. / JD / Juris Doctor) from a fully accredited law school
  • An active member in good standing with the State Bar Association in VA
  • Ideally 3+ years of Personal Injury / auto liability / MVA experience
  • Ability to manage high volume of litigation cases
  • Excellent client service and communication skills
  • Self-starter driven by long-term career goals
  • Superior writing and oral advocacy skills
